Gregory Harper

Bass Trombonist Gregory Harper has been a member of the Colorado Symphony since 1997. A native of Massachusetts, he began his musical training at age 10. He holds degrees from Rice University “Shepherd School of Music,” as well as University of Massachusetts – Amherst. Prior to joining the Colorado Symphony, he was the interim Bass Trombonist with L’Orquesta Sinfonica de Galicia of La Coruna, Spain. Greg has also played with the Houston, Minnesota and Montreal Symphony and can be heard as guest Bass Trombonist on the 2014 Grammy Award winning record of Sibelius Symphony No. 1 and 4 with the Minnesota Orchestra under Maestro Osmo Vanska. As a guest clinician and lecturer, he was the featured guest artist at the 1998 International Trombone Association Workshop, the 2001 South Shore Low Brass Symposium held in Middleboro, Massachusetts, and the Fairbanks Summer Arts Festival. Greg has taught Trombone Pedagogy at Colorado State University in Fort Collins, Colorado and is currently Adjunct Professor of Trombone at Colorado Christian University in Lakewood, Colorado. He is an artist/clinician for the Edwards Trombone Corporation.
